From: amitkuma Date: Wed, 2 Aug 2017 16:36:54 +0000 (+0530) Subject: client: Added NULL check before dereference X-Git-Tag: v12.1.3~77^2 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=9e4ab4a7b538f63a7f6e893914c41db535801b69;p=ceph.git client: Added NULL check before dereference Fixed: ** 1405291 Explicit null dereferenced. CID 1405291 (#1 of 1): Explicit null dereferenced (FORWARD_NULL) 10. var_deref_op: Dereferencing null pointer s. Signed-off-by: Amit Kumar amitkuma@redhat.com --- diff --git a/src/client/Client.cc b/src/client/Client.cc index 6b34e4a330e4..db113f180636 100644 --- a/src/client/Client.cc +++ b/src/client/Client.cc @@ -12900,6 +12900,7 @@ void Client::ms_handle_remote_reset(Connection *con) } } if (mds >= 0) { + assert (s != NULL); switch (s->state) { case MetaSession::STATE_CLOSING: ldout(cct, 1) << "reset from mds we were closing; we'll call that closed" << dendl;